Output 66a3a945493ffc75fe24ec6a756f298ac1b0b506c041fdfa3b82e0fcd500333b:1

value
414882925
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d4e90d0434df172faf1a39cd8822194c0e68a1e OP_EQUALVERIFY OP_CHECKSIG
address
1Q6N5Naigcem53FMP6buSPdwntDhUyrikL
transaction
66a3a945493ffc75fe24ec6a756f298ac1b0b506c041fdfa3b82e0fcd500333b
confirmations
411979
spent
true